Pitching development has changed dramatically over the last decade. In this episode, I am joined by Tyler Zombro, the Special Assistant to the Cubs Pitching Director. We talk about the biggest developments in pitching – why velocity isn’t everything, how pitch shapes and biomechanics change the way pitchers train, and how organizations like the Cubs use data to maximize every arm in their system. Plus, we dive into the critical aspect of transparency between teams and players, the mistakes players and parents are making in youth baseball, and what free agents need to consider before signing with a team.
